Transaction 07555308adeebde91011f23d441b2e98b50688ee9e5e2be2f037a047b0c339ef
1 Input
2 Outputs
- 07555308adeebde91011f23d441b2e98b50688ee9e5e2be2f037a047b0c339ef:0
- 07555308adeebde91011f23d441b2e98b50688ee9e5e2be2f037a047b0c339ef:1
value 646726
address 3NYWhs3YhRkmn2BaLwfM15g8Lk8apzPYxQ
value 413607
address 191VFUNFiVYehBcKoKCGCKrb2uSQVMpY6q